Q: What skills will I gain from this diploma?
By completing the Level 6 Diploma in Occupational Health and Safety Management, you will gain a range of skills, including the ability to develop and implement effective health and safety policies, conduct risk assessments, and manage workplace hazards. You will also learn to analyze and interpret health and safety data, and develop strategies to improve workplace safety and reduce accidents. Additionally, you will develop strong communication and leadership skills, enabling you to effectively manage and motivate teams to prioritize health and safety. These skills will be highly valued by employers and will enhance your career prospects in the field of occupational health and safety management. Upon completion of the course, you will be well-equipped to take on senior health and safety roles and make a positive impact in your organization.
